Why we choose atomization technology?
Atomization is the process of breaking a liquid into small droplets, and it has many effects, including:
  • Spray behavior
    Atomization is a key factor in spray behavior, and is important for the combustion of liquid fuels, coating, and painting. 
  • Surface area
    Atomization increases the surface area of a liquid, which can help with evaporation or combustion. 
  • Particle and powder creation
    Atomization can create particles and powders. For example, gas atomization can produce fine spherical powders. 
Atomization is achieved by passing a high-velocity air stream near the tip of a nozzle. The extent of atomization depends on several factors, including:
  • Nozzle designThe design of the nozzle affects the level of atomization.
  • Spray rateThe spray rate affects the level of atomization.
  • Liquid viscosityThe viscosity of the liquid affects the level of atomization.
  • Atomizing air volumeThe volume of the atomizing air affects the level of atomization. 
Some common examples of atomization in everyday life include shower heads, perfume sprays, garden hoses, and hair sprays.
